This was a tough one.
I bought JJ's SD last year and I really enjoy wearing it. I bought an 'M' Sub Date in February with the engraved rehaute and in April I was lucky enough to buy a perfect 'K' 14060M from Sleedawg on this Forum.

So far I have worn the SD and the 14046M often but the Sub Date is seldom worn. I have, however, examined each one very carefully and in my considered opinion the winner is........the 14060M.

It has a symetry that I find I like very much. It's interesting that two of the other most sought after Rolex watches also have this feature. The Milgauss GV and the Daytona SS.

As I type this the 14060m is on the winder ready to go back to work tomorrow.
